然而,无论你是初学者还是经验丰富的数据库管理员,确保MySQL正确安装是迈向成功应用的第一步
本文将详细阐述如何确定MySQL安装成功,涵盖从安装过程到验证安装的各个方面,旨在为你提供一份全面而详尽的指南
一、安装前的准备工作 在安装MySQL之前,有几项准备工作必不可少,以确保安装过程顺利进行
1.操作系统选择: MySQL支持多种操作系统,包括Windows、Linux、macOS等
根据你的实际需求选择合适的操作系统版本
2.下载MySQL安装包: 访问MySQL官方网站,下载与你操作系统相匹配的MySQL安装包
确保下载的是最新版本,以获得最新的功能和安全修复
3.系统要求检查: 在安装前,检查你的系统是否满足MySQL的最低硬件和软件要求
这包括内存、存储空间、操作系统版本等
4.用户权限: 确保你有足够的权限来安装软件,特别是在Linux或macOS系统上,通常需要管理员权限
二、MySQL的安装过程 安装MySQL的过程因操作系统而异,以下是Windows和Linux系统的安装步骤
Windows系统安装步骤: 1.运行安装包: 双击下载的MySQL安装包,启动安装向导
2.选择安装类型: 在安装类型选择界面中,通常会有多种选项,如“Developer Default”、“Server only”、“Full”、“Custom”等
根据你的需求选择合适的安装类型
对于大多数用户来说,“Developer Default”或“Full”是不错的选择
3.配置MySQL Server: 在安装过程中,会出现一个配置MySQL Server的界面
在这里,你需要设置MySQL的root密码、选择配置类型(如Development Machine、Server Machine、Dedicated MySQL Server Machine等)、配置InnoDB等
4.安装并应用配置: 完成配置后,点击“Next”继续安装
安装完成后,应用配置并启动MySQL服务
Linux系统安装步骤(以Ubuntu为例): 1.更新软件包列表: 打开终端,运行以下命令以更新软件包列表: bash sudo apt update 2.安装MySQL Server: 运行以下命令安装MySQL Server: bash sudo apt install mysql-server 3.配置MySQL: 安装完成后,MySQL服务会自动启动
你需要运行`mysql_secure_installation`脚本来配置MySQL的root密码和一些安全选项
4.启动和停止MySQL服务: 你可以使用以下命令来启动和停止MySQL服务: bash sudo systemctl start mysql sudo systemctl stop mysql 三、验证MySQL安装成功 安装完成后,通过一系列步骤验证MySQL是否成功安装并正常运行至关重要
以下是一些常用的验证方法
1. 检查MySQL服务状态 在Windows系统上,你可以通过“服务”管理器查看MySQL服务的状态
确保MySQL服务正在运行
在Linux系统上,你可以使用以下命令检查MySQL服务的状态: bash sudo systemctl status mysql 如果MySQL服务正在运行,你将看到类似“active(running)”的状态信息
2. 使用MySQL命令行客户端 无论在哪个操作系统上,你都可以通过MySQL命令行客户端连接到MySQL服务器,以验证安装是否成功
在Windows系统上,你可以在命令提示符下输入以下命令: bash mysql -u root -p 然后输入你设置的root密码
在Linux系统上,命令相同: bash mysql -u root -p 如果连接成功,你将看到MySQL的提示符,类似于`mysql`,这表示你可以开始执行SQL命令了
3. 执行基本SQL命令 连接到MySQL服务器后,执行一些基本的SQL命令,以进一步验证安装
-查看MySQL版本: sql SELECT VERSION(); 这将返回MySQL的版本信息
-显示数据库列表: sql SHOW DATABASES; 这将列出所有数据库,默认情况下应包括`information_schema`、`mysql`、`performance_schema`、`sys`等数据库
-创建并查询数据库: 你可以创建一个新的数据库,并插入一些数据,然后查询这些数据,以确保MySQL能够正常工作
sql CREATE DATABASE testdb; USE testdb; CREATE TABLE testtable(id INT AUTO_INCREMENT PRIMARY KEY, name VARCHAR(100)); INSERT INTO testtable(name) VALUES(Hello, MySQL!); SELECTFROM testtable; 4. 检查日志文件 MySQL的日志文件是诊断问题和验证安装的重要资源
你可以查看MySQL的错误日志文件,以确保没有错误或警告信息
在Windows系统上,错误日志文件通常位于MySQL安装目录下的`data`文件夹中,文件名类似于`hostname.err`
在Linux系统上,错误日志文件通常位于`/var/log/mysql/`或`/var/log/`目录下,文件名可能是`error.log`或`hostname.err`
你可以使用`cat`、`less`或`tail`命令查看日志文件的内容
例如: bash sudo tail -f /var/log/mysql/error.log 5. 使用图形化管理工具 除了命令行客户端外,你还可以使用图形化管理工具来验证MySQL的安装
这些工具提供了更直观的界面,使管理MySQL数据库变得更加容易
-MySQL Workbench: MySQL官方提供的图形化管理工具,支持数据库设计、SQL开发、服务器配置等功能
-phpMyAdmin: 一个基于Web的MySQL管理工具,广泛用于管理MySQL数据库
-DBeaver: 一个通用的数据库管理工具,支持多种数据库,包括MySQL
通过这些工具,你可以连接到MySQL服务器,查看数据库列表、执行SQL查询、管理用户和权限等
四、解决常见问题 在安装和验证MySQL的过程中,可能会遇到一些常见问题
以下是一些常见问题的解决方法: 1.无法连接到MySQL服务器: - 确保MySQL服务正在运行
- 检查防火墙设置,确保MySQL的端口(默认是3306)没有被阻塞
- 检查MySQL的配置文件(如`my.cnf`或`my.ini`),确保绑定地址正确(通常是`127.0.0.1`或`localhost`)
2.密码错误: - 如果你忘记了root密码,可以通过重置密码来解决
在Linux系统上,你可以停止MySQL服务,以安全模式启动MySQL,然后重置root密码
3.权限问题: - 确保你有足够的权限来访问MySQL服务器和执行SQL命令
4.日志文件错误: - 检查MySQL的错误日志文件,查找任何错误或警告信息,并根据日志中的提示进行故障排除
五、总结 通过本文的介绍,你应该已经了解了如何确定MySQL安装成功
从安装前的准备工作到安装过程,再到验证安装的各个方面,本文都进行了详尽的阐述
确保MySQL正确安装并正常运行是数据库管理的关键一步,希望本文能够帮助你顺利完成这一任务
如果你在安装或验证过程中遇到任何问题,可以参考本文提供的解决方